Apparently deleting all 3D overlays in J_Kihon disables the question block and brick block animations. I haven't tested the other standard tilesets.

It's possible. I noticed the overlays for those tiles as well as the used block tile have less transparency then the actual tile, compared to other tiles which are the other way around.

Will test and edit.

EDIT: Test confirms it. The "question blocks" in the picture below are actually concrete blocks with the 3d overlay switched to that of a question block.
